C740 Water based Stencil Cleaning Machine
The C740 is a high-performance water-based stencil cleaning equipment, which uses water-based liquid cleaning agents and DI water for rinsing. It is specially designed for cleaning various types of stencils and PCBAs, such as SMT steel mesh, copper mesh, plastic mesh, resin mesh, printing glue fixtures, PCB misprinted boards and a small amount of PCBA.

1. How is the cleaning effect of your equipment? Can it be thoroughly cleaned?
A:Of course! Our equipment uses high-pressure spraying + precision filtration technology, which can effectively remove solder paste, red glue and flux residues on the steel mesh to ensure the cleanliness of the steel mesh. At the same time, there is a drying function after cleaning to ensure that the steel mesh is dry and has no residue, and can be put into use immediately.

5. Is it difficult to maintain the equipment? Is the later cost high?
A:Our equipment design is very user-friendly, simple to maintain and low cost. You only need to regularly replace the cleaning agent and check the filter system, and other parts are basically maintenance-free. 7.Can your stencil cleaning machine improve production efficiency?
A:Of course! It usually takes 3-10 minutes to clean a stencil, which is much faster and more effective than traditional manual cleaning. It also has a stable cleaning effect. It reduces printing defects caused by unclean stencils, improves production yield, and ultimately helps you reduce costs and increase production capacity.
